Edward McHugh is an artist from Philadelphia whose work includes photography and sculpture.
Education and work
Trained as a painter, printmaker, and sculptor, McHugh graduated from the Hussian School of Art in Philadelphia in 1991. He later studied at Crown Point Press in San Francisco.
After beginning to work in photographic methods, McHugh began to implement a process he termed a "wax-diffused pigment print." By applying a thin layer of archival wax to the surface of the print, McHugh imbues a painterly brushstroke to the image giving it a uniquely handmade surface, marrying his fine arts background and his photographic process. The Seattle Times described an image of the battleship USS New Jersey treated with this technique, saying that "the effect is both enchanting and unsettling".
